Warning Signs You Need Warehouse Water Damage Restoration

Catching water damage early can save you thousands of dollars in repairs and prevent further damage to your property. Here are some common warning signs to look out for: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ong, unpleasant odors can be a sign of hidden moisture in your warehouse. If you notice a persistent musty smell, it’s time to call in the experts. We’ll use specialized equipment to detect hidden moisture and prevent further damage.

Water Stains or Warping on Walls or Floors

Visible water stains or warping on walls or floors can be a sign of water damage. If you notice any of these signs, don’t delay – contact us today. We’ll assess the damage and provide a comprehensive plan to repair and restore your warehouse.

Discoloration or Bubbling on Ceilings or Walls

Discoloration or bubbling on ceilings or walls can be a sign of water damage or moisture buildup. If you notice any of these signs, it’s time to call in the experts. We’ll use specialized equipment to detect hidden moisture and prevent further damage.

Water Damage to Electrical Systems or Appliances

Water damage to electrical systems or appliances can be a serious safety hazard. If you notice any signs of water damage to these areas, don’t delay – contact us today. We’ll assess the damage and provide a comprehensive plan to repair and restore your warehouse.

Visible Puddles or Standing Water

Visible puddles or standing water can be a sign of a larger issue. If you notice any of these signs, don’t delay – contact us today. We’ll assess the damage and provide a comprehensive plan to repair and restore your warehouse.

Increased Humidity or Moisture Levels

Increased humidity or moisture levels can be a sign of water damage or moisture buildup. If you notice any of these signs, it’s time to call in the experts. We’ll use specialized equipment to detect hidden moisture and prevent further damage.

Warehouse Water Damage Restoration Cost In Lancaster, MA

The cost of Warehouse Water Damage Restoration in Lancaster, MA can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our team will provide you with a comprehensive estimate and work closely with you to ensure you understand the costs involved. We’ll also work with your insurance company to ensure a smooth claims process.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Extraction and Drying $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, severity of damage, and local conditions
Repair and Reconstruction $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area, type of repairs needed, and local labor costs
Final Inspection and Cleaning $200 – $1,000 Size of affected area and type of cleaning needed
Assessment and Inspection $100 – $500 Size of affected area and complexity of assessment
Equipment Rental and Use $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area and type of equipment needed
More Services (e.g. Mold remediation) $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area and type of service needed

Exact pricing will depend on an on-site assessment and will be provided to you in your comprehensive estimate. We offer free estimates and will work closely with you to ensure you understand the costs involved.
